Medical professionals employ titration of medications to determine the appropriate balance for each patient, with minimal adverse effects. They collaborate closely with patients to assess their symptoms and perform regular checkups.

Medicines

Inadequate dosage of medication can result in poor outcomes and persistent symptoms that compromise the patient's health. By regularly monitoring patients and adjusting dosages when needed healthcare professionals can customize medication to meet the unique requirements of every patient. This personal approach helps optimize the effectiveness of treatment and reduce side effects, improving the overall quality of life for patients.

Medication titration is a complicated procedure that requires constant monitoring and adjustments. It involves assessing a number of factors such as the patient's weight, age, and overall health, as well their medical conditions and their allergies. Professionals in healthcare also consider the interactions between medications. This helps them determine a starting dosage and then adjust it to the ideal dosage for the patient.

The medication titration process is a joint effort that involves doctors, pharmacists and nurses. Each of these professionals play a crucial role in the success or failure of the process. Doctors are the ones who prescribe the initial dose, Titration process and to conduct regular examinations to check the patient’s response to the drug. They also take into account any medical issues that might affect the titration process, as well as the preferences of the patient and lifestyle aspects.

Pharmacists are crucial to the medication titration process as they provide important information about side effects and interactions between drugs. They can also make recommendations for dosage adjustments in light of their experience and knowledge of latest research in medicine. Additionally, pharmacists should provide patients with information on proper dosage administration.

Nursing is another important part of the titration process as it is vital to accurately document and communicate any changes in patient medication. However, it is often difficult for nurses in critical care to keep up with the titration process because of high turnover rates, staffing issues during the COVID-19 pandemic and limited opportunities for training. Due to this, documentation and instructions for medication titration can be inconsistent between departments.

Healthcare professionals should adopt new standards to ensure the accuracy of dosages of medications. These standards should include standard instructions and procedures for titration and guidelines for assessments of patients and documentation. This will ensure that all healthcare professionals are using the same titration plans and that patients receive consistent, accurate treatment.

Food

Food industry uses titration to test for purity and the content. It also serves to control quality. Titration, for instance can be used to determine the amount of salt present in the food item. It can also be used to test the pH of a food or beverage. It is also a method to determine how acidic a food is important when it comes to the dairy industry and products like milk that contain a high amount of lactic acid and low pH.

The amount of chemical flavours that are added to food can also be determined using the technique of titration. It is essential to ensure the right quantity of these chemicals are added to foods to maintain their nutritional value, taste and color.

The manufacturing industry also utilizes Titration to determine the chemical makeup of the materials. This is particularly true in industries like food processing, pharmaceuticals and chemical manufacturing. It is also used to create biodiesel-based fuels using vegetable oil. It can help determine how much base is required to achieve the proper pH level to biodiesel.
